- I am looking for a C programmer who is willing to implement FEAL and N-Hash.
- FEAL is a block algorithm from Japan; N-Hash is a one-way hash function from
- the same place. Eli Biham and Adi Shamir made mincemeat out of them with
- differential cryptanalysis, but they still have some interest.
